Job Description & Requirements

Interstate Engineering is looking to expand our Western region team with the addition of a Senior Municipal Engineer.

As a Senior Municipal Engineer, you will play a key role in the design of municipal engineering and roadway projects; lead a multi-disciplinary team using your technical and management skills; utilize your technical expertise by being hands‑on during the design process; direct your team by providing technical direction and expertise; use project management skills for organizing, planning, and directing work activities and budgets; foster and build our client base through interpersonal relationships; contribute to business development opportunities including preparing proposals and leading client meetings; and construction management.

Knowledge of the Following is Preferred:

  • Experience with the design of municipal facilities (water, storm sewer, wastewater, roadways)
  • Understanding of municipal and state governments
  • Understanding of municipal project funding and sources of funds

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or related field
  • Licensed Professional Engineer in Montana or ability to obtain within six months
  • Technical knowledge of engineering principles and practices
  • Experience with project management and budgeting
  • The capability of supervising, mentoring, and evaluating staff
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ills and the ability to work in a team atmosphere is vital
  • Ability to prioritize and handle multiple projects and clients
  • Good driving record and valid driver’s license
